Overall verdict: fundamentals indicate distress and very low earnings reliability, so the stock screens as strong sell for a 6-12 month horizon. The auditor issued a disclaimer of conclusion on both standalone and consolidated Q3 FY26 results, explicitly saying it could not verify completeness/validity of transactions because key records were unavailable. Operating momentum is severely weak: consolidated revenue from operations fell to about Rs 26.66 lakh in Q3 FY26 (vs Rs 6,298.20 lakh in Q3 FY25) and to Rs 1,653.08 lakh in 9M FY26 (vs Rs 22,799.41 lakh in 9M FY25), while the parent reported a 9M net loss of Rs 6,581.37 lakh with basic EPS of -20.05. Liquidity and solvency risk remain elevated, with net current liabilities of Rs 54,363.19 lakh and explicit going-concern uncertainty noted by management.

AI Investment Score & Analysis

+ Key Strengths

The company had previously executed a slump sale of the FIBC business (completed 30 April 2024) and reported an exceptional gain of Rs 37,760.23 lakh, which materially strengthened reported historical profitability.
It also recorded a one-time settlement gain of Rs 16,585.09 lakh (quarter ended 30 June 2024), showing active liability restructuring efforts with lenders/investors.
Despite disruption, operations are not fully shut: consolidated revenue from operations was still positive at Rs 1,653.08 lakh in 9M FY26.
The group has capped further P&L drag from its associate by not recognizing additional Rs 1,183.95 lakh share of losses after investment value reached nil and no funding obligation existed under Ind AS 28.
Paid-up equity capital remains Rs 3,282.28 lakh, providing some residual capital base while restructuring/normalization efforts continue.

- Key Risks

Auditor disclaimer on both standalone and consolidated results: significant limitations in accessing complete financial information mean reported numbers could be misstated.
Severe demand/operations collapse: consolidated Q3 revenue from operations declined to about Rs 26.66 lakh from Rs 6,298.20 lakh YoY, and 9M revenue fell to Rs 1,653.08 lakh from Rs 22,799.41 lakh.
Profitability is deeply negative on current run-rate: parent reported 9M net loss of Rs 6,581.37 lakh and Q3 basic EPS of -8.93 (9M EPS -20.05).
Balance-sheet stress is acute: net current liabilities are Rs 54,363.19 lakh, and management states operations are presently based on drawing power sanctioned by banks in November 2025.
Going-concern risk is explicitly disclosed; inability to access server/primary records and missing bank statements from all banks undermine financial control and visibility.

Forward Outlook

No fresh growth project, capacity expansion, or new product catalyst was announced for Q3 FY26; disclosures were dominated by record-access disruption and financial control issues. Near-term performance will depend on restoration of primary records/server access, full bank reconciliation, and removal of the auditor’s disclaimer in upcoming quarters. Reported strategic actions are mostly historical (FY25 slump sale and one-time settlements), not new quarter-specific growth initiatives. Based on current trajectory, momentum is decelerating sharply, and the next 2-4 quarters are likely to be driven more by stabilization/liquidity outcomes than by expansion-led earnings growth.

Flexituff Ventures International Limited faces severe operational and financial distress with a disclaimer of conclusion from auditors due to inability to access complete financial records and supporting documents. The company reported a consolidated net loss of Rs 6,581.37 lakhs for nine months ended December 2025, down from a profit of Rs 24,948.25 lakhs in the prior year (which included one-time gains of Rs 16,585.09 lakhs from debt settlement and Rs 37,760.23 lakhs from business sale). The auditors explicitly noted significant doubt on the company's ability to continue as a going concern, citing disruption of financial obligations, operational losses, and net current liability position of Rs 46,000+ lakhs. Without access to primary records, bank statements, or verification of transactions, the financial statements cannot be relied upon for investment decisions.

Forward Outlook

The company faces immediate existential threats with no positive catalysts visible. Management has not announced any new initiatives, expansion plans, or strategic projects in the current quarter - instead focusing on survival amid loss of access to financial systems and manufacturing records. The withdrawal of banking facilities in November 2025 and auditor's going concern warning indicate potential insolvency or restructuring scenarios ahead. With unverifiable financial statements, missing documentation, and operational collapse, investors should expect either a comprehensive debt restructuring, asset liquidation, or potential corporate insolvency proceedings in the next 2-4 quarters. No forward guidance was provided, and the momentum is clearly negative across all operational and financial dimensions.

Strengths

Business Transfer Agreement executed in FY24 generated exceptional gain of Rs 37,760.23 lakhs from sale of FIBC business to Flexituff Technology International Limited, though this was a one-time event
One-time settlement with IFCI Ltd and FCCB holders (TPG Growth II, IFC) in Q1 FY25 resulted in Rs 16,585.09 lakhs gain, providing temporary relief from debt obligations
The company operates in technical textiles segment with presence across 14 subsidiaries globally including UK and Cyprus entities
Prior restructuring efforts with consortium banks attempted to transfer Rs 8,394.96 lakhs of bank limits to the subsidiary FTIL

Risks

Auditor issued disclaimer of conclusion citing inability to access server, financial records at manufacturing plant, and complete bank statements - making financial results unverifiable and unreliable
Company disclosed disruption of financial obligations and operational losses in November 2025, with auditors noting significant doubt on going concern ability
Net current liabilities position exceeds Rs 46,000 lakhs with working capital facilities withdrawn by banks in November 2025, creating severe liquidity crisis
Consolidated net loss of Rs 6,581.37 lakhs for nine months FY26 versus profit of Rs 24,948.25 lakhs prior year (which included Rs 54,345.32 lakhs in one-time gains), indicating core operations are deeply unprofitable
Deferred tax assets recognized without sufficient evidence of future taxable profits, with management unable to provide supporting documentation due to missing records
Foreign subsidiaries Flexiglobal Holding (Cyprus) and Flexiglobal UK are under liquidation process with assets of Rs 547.28 lakhs, signaling global operations failure
